Transaction 99652240d1c6b352b68267ec9a8cd217742a8867d592e93d5b2b71b22f11ec62
1 Input
1 Output
-
99652240d1c6b352b68267ec9a8cd217742a8867d592e93d5b2b71b22f11ec62:0
- value
- 11386339
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 20bc96edc89aee88a155be0c585ecce53390765e OP_EQUAL
- address
- 34g7U7dNYmPPMPtha2obHtT5gVbhAguDvH